Government calls for ‘immediate’ ceasefire in Israel-Hamas war and urges EU and regional partners to provide financial support
Mr Varadkar said the Government condemned unequivocally the bombing of Al-Ahli Arab Hospital in Gaza on Tuesday night, which violated the rules of war and basic humanity and that it “might yet prove to be a war crime”.
The Government put forward a motion in the Dáil on Wednesday night condemning the attack by Hamas on October 7th, the hospital bombing and calling for an immediate humanitarian ceasefire to meet the “urgent humanitarian needs of all civilians in Gaza”. It also emphasised Israel’s right to defend itself from attack must be line with international law and that it had responsibilities in respect of the “basic needs” of the population of Gaza including food, water, medical and energy supplies and called for them to be urgently restored., for what it said was her “unqualified support” for Israel and also called for the immediate recognition by Ireland of the State of Palestine.
Labour leader Ivana Bacik said there was a need for an independent international investigation to be carried out into Tuesday night’s attack on the hospital which should be done by the International Criminal Court.
